Whirlpool (WHR) Misses Q2 EPS by 19c, Offers Outlook

July 26, 2017 4:32 PM EDT

Whirlpool (NYSE: WHR) reported Q2 EPS of $3.35, $0.19 worse than the analyst estimate of $3.54. Revenue for the quarter came in at $5.3 billion versus the consensus estimate of $5.35 billion.
